BSMRMU 11th Syndicate Meeting held

block
Campus Report :
The 11th meeting of the Syndicate of Bangabandhu Sheikh Mujibur Rahman Maritime University, Bangladesh (BSMRMU) was held at the university’s temporary campus at Pallabi in the capital recently. Vice-Chancellor Rear Admiral ASM Abdul Baten chaired the meeting. The approval to conduct Masters/ Diploma in the evening section on Tourism and Hospitality Management, Coastal Zone Management, Dredging and Harbour Engineering and Land and Water Management and Regulation for Transportation and various academic and administrative decisions have been taken in the meeting.
The university is successfully conducting two batches of ‘LLM Maritime Law’ and ‘Master in Port and Shipping Management’ and a batch of BSc (Hons) in Oceanography programs.
The university planned to launch ‘Naval Architecture and Ocean Engineering’ and many honours and masters programs very soon.
After completing courses the students will be able to build their career as skilled maritime professionals at home and abroad.
The university is determined to contribute to the development of maritime human resource of the nation and uplift the nation’s economy to ‘Blue Economy’, added the Vice-Chancellor.
The syndicate members also expressed their satisfaction by the recent initiatives taken by the university in enhancing maritime education.
